Trove is a recommerce technology company founded in 2012 and headquartered in Brisbane, California. The company builds and operates white-label branded resale programs on behalf of major consumer brands — enabling them to launch, manage, and scale their own secondary market channels under their own brand names rather than losing resale volume to third-party platforms like ThredUp, Poshmark, or The RealReal. Trove handles the end-to-end operational complexity: trade-in and take-back logistics, item receiving and grading, cleaning, photography, pricing, and resale fulfillment — all on behalf of the brand partner.

eBay is a San Jose-based global e-commerce marketplace connecting hundreds of millions of buyers and sellers across 190+ markets — facilitating the purchase and sale of new and pre-owned goods across electronics, fashion, collectibles, parts and accessories, home and garden, and virtually every product category through both auction-style and fixed-price listings. Listed on NASDAQ (NASDAQ: EBAY), eBay generated $9.8 billion in revenue and $73.1 billion in gross merchandise volume (GMV) in 2023, serving 132 million active buyers worldwide.
